Customer Engagement Officer (Digital) Salary: £41,185 + excellent benefits Location: Letchworth Garden City or High Wycombe Hybrid working: Two days per week in the office, and three days from home (with occasional travel between offices and in the community) Contract: 12-month fixed term contract Hours: Full time, 37 hours per week (Monday - Friday) Are you looking to join a growing, values-led organisation with a clear social purpose? At SettleParadigm, we’re proud to be the largest housing group in the region, managing over 30,000 homes across Buckinghamshire, Bedfordshire, and Hertfordshire. Everything we do is about delivering excellent services, high quality homes, neighbourhoods we can be proud of and maximising number of new affordable homes we build. Through our merger we’ve brought together shared values, skills and ambition, so we can build more affordable homes and make an even bigger difference in the communities we serve If you're ready to grow your career in a supportive, inclusive environment while helping to shape stronger communities, we’d love to welcome you on our journey. Together, we’re building a better future. We're looking for a Customer Engagement Officer (Digital) to join our Customer Insight and Influence team on a 12-month fixed-term contract. This is a key role where you will shape how we engage with residents online and help ensure their voices influence decisions across the organisation. If you are passionate about digital engagement, user experience and creating accessible online journeys, this is a brilliant opportunity to make a meaningful impact. About the Role You will lead the evolution of our digital engagement platform, "Connect", and help us build a modern, accessible and resident friendly online experience. You will design digital journeys, create engaging content, analyse user behaviour and support colleagues to deliver high quality digital engagement across a range of projects. You will also play a central role in the redesign and rebrand of the Connect platform, working closely with Communications, IT and colleagues across the business. This is a hands on role that blends digital content design, UX, analytics, project management and resident engagement. Key Responsibilities: Act as the go to expert for digital engagement across SettleParadigm Manage day to day activity on the Connect platform including content creation, publishing and optimisation Design clear and intuitive user journeys that make it easy for residents to take part Create engaging digital content including pages, surveys and interactive tools Ensure accessibility to Web Content Accessibility Guidelines Level AA Develop resident friendly email and SMS communications using segmentation and targeting Analyse engagement data using GA4, Tag Manager or similar tools Translate insight into recommendations that influence decision making Train and support colleagues to create and publish content Project manage the Connect platform relaunch for Autumn twenty twenty six Review and improve our digital engagement offer with input from residents and colleagues Support use of CX Feedback to improve local engagement and customer surveys Support impact assessments and help publicise outcomes through articles, blogs and stories Support in person engagement including Big Door Knocks and local events What We’re Looking For Must haves: Experience designing and delivering digital engagement or digital research Experience creating accessible digital content and communications Experience mapping and improving user journeys using UX and inclusive design Experience designing mobile first experiences Experience using analytics tools such as GA4, Tag Manager or Hotjar Experience working with accessibility standards Strong project management skills Strong verbal communication skills Strong written communication skills for content and reporting Strong analytical skills Ability to build relationships with colleagues and customers Ability to work independently and deliver end to end initiatives Flexibility and comfort with change Nice to haves: Experience working in housing or a regulated service Experience managing risk in public facing digital content Experience planning and running usability testing Experience designing and delivering customer surveys Confidence in facilitation and presenting An innovative mindset with creative problem solving Benefits At SettleParadigm, we believe in creating an environment where our people feel valued, supported, and inspired to grow. Our comprehensive benefits and rewards package reflects this commitment. annual salary: £ 41,185 per annum 25 days holiday, increasing with service, plus Christmas closure and buy options Generous pension scheme – up to 9.5% employer contribution via salary sacrifice Family-friendly leave : Enhanced maternity, paternity, and adoption leave Health cash plan – claim up to £1,800 for everyday health costs (plus free kids’ cover) Life cover and income protection Flexible working – hybrid options, modern offices, free parking & EV charging And that’s just the beginning! We’re also thrilled to provide: Mental Health First Aiders available to support Car leasing via salary sacrifice (for permanent colleagues subject to conditions) Funded training, qualifications & apprenticeships 3 paid volunteering days in the local communities Peer-recognition rewards platform Paid professional subscription (one per year) Working Hours & Additional Pay 37 hours per week, Monday - Friday.
